When I have free time (as if I ever have any), I like to amuse myself with any of these projects. Much of the code I've written in my spare time is available under open-source licensing terms. For more information, please feel free to check out the following sites:
  • smartos is a data center orchestration platform from MNX. It's built on SmartOS, a descendant of Solaris.
  • Fins is a Model-View-Controller (MVC) web application framework written in Pike. This website is a web application built using Fins, called FinScribe.
  • SpeedyDelivery, a mailing list server with a web based front end.
  • tunesd is a iTunes Music Sharing server that allows you to share your music library with iTunes and Roku devices.
  • Caudium is a modular web/application server written in C and Pike. I'm currently the project leader.
  • GotPike is the community home for the Pike programming language.
  • OpenHAB is a home automation platform written in Java. I've written a number of add-on bundles, such as for Venstar Thermostats and the terrific Weatherflow SmartWeather stations.
